Serious Honda Sh50E and Vauxhall Cavalier crash on the A39 - 14 Sep 1992

Accident reference 199250A411407

Serious Accident

Accident summary

On Monday 14 September 1992 at 07:55 a serious collision occurred near A39 involving 2 vehicles (honda sh50e, vauxhall cavalier) and 1 casualty (1 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as raining no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.

Key details

  • Posted speed limit: 40 mph
  • Road type: Dual carriageway
